The International Olympic Committee has confirmed that Singapore will host its first-ever E-Sports week in 2023. As per the IOC, the four-day event will take place between June 22 and June 25, 2023. It will be conducted as joint collaboration between the Ministry of Culture, Community and Youth, Sport Singapore, and the Singapore National Olympic Committee.
